    I have a table with Business services down the X axis and Business units across the Y axis as headers. how can I change the order that the business unit (or really any header in any table) appears? I'd like the columns to be sorted left to right in either alpha or descending order.

    You can click and drag each column header left or right to a new position in the report table.

     

    Here's an example of alphabetically sorted business unit column headers.

    To produce the table above, I also froze the position of the Service Name column.

    (right-click column header name > Freeze Column)

     

    Manual positioning is the only option for table column order.

     

    Table row order on the other hand can be set for ascending or descending for each field listed in the Rows section of your ad hoc query configuration dialog:
